Strawbs Artist Snapshot:

Led by British guitarist/vocalist Dave Cousins, the Strawbs started life in the mid '60s as a genial bluegrass unit called the Strawberry Hill Boys. They soon glided into a folkier sound, adding a pre-Fairport Convention Sandy Denny on vocals and shortening their name to the Strawbs. By the time of their 1969 debut album, Denny was gone, and the band had further evolved, incorporating rock and neo-classical elements, portending the '70s prog wave about to hit unsuspecting rock fans. The band continued to make creative, well-received albums for much of the next decade, never quite cracking the U.S. market but liked by fans and critics. The constant shuffling of personnel would plague the band, although Cousins managed to keep some version of the Strawbs alive into the 2000s.

Title Note

The Strawbs' fourth album, 1971's FROM THE WITCHWOOD is the key transition point between the group's folk-rock roots and the more commercial pop sound of their later records, and is also the last to include Rick Wakeman's keyboards.
